Android:使用testCoverageEnabled true
将Gradle升级到7.0.x和jdk 11后,不会生成Jacoco代码覆盖率。它在使用gradle 4.2.x和jdk 8时运行良好。
我尝试使用gradle 7.0.x删除testCoverageEnabled true
,它再次开始工作。即使将其设置为false(testCoverageEnabled false
),它也会工作。但jacoco文档说将其标记为true仅用于生成测试覆盖率报告。
在gradle 4.2和jdk 8中,它运行良好;现在在gradle 7.0和jdk 11中,它在删除布尔值后运行正常。
任何人都可以帮助我了解更多关于这一点,它是如何工作,如果删除testCoverageEnabled true
或它设置为假?
1条答案
按热度按时间f0brbegy1#
如果有人错过了dev2505的注解,完全删除
testCoverageEnabled
似乎可以解决这个问题。